This US based company is advertising for the products mentioned above on your mail pages in this country. It offers a 'free trial' of

products, all it charges is the postage. However, as I and hundreds, if not thousands of your customers have found out, what is not revealed is that unless you notify them within about two weeks they assume that you have signed up for their products - this is not explained or mentioned in their adverts. The first thing you know about it is when you get your card details and notice that between £55 to £68 pounds per product has been billed. In my case it came to nearly £190. Other customers noticed this later and went several hundreds of pounds out of pocket.
